Output 68528947ec8cd63f98734cf67abeb141f44f8c05f2b6b03324942b9f75c0c337:49

value
21251500
script pubkey
OP_0 OP_PUSHBYTES_20 ef8361a7cb1d6d46014c5a301c79afa2de4b0ca3
address
ltc1qa7pkrf7tr4k5vq2vtgcpc7d05t0ykr9rwpk9qq
transaction
68528947ec8cd63f98734cf67abeb141f44f8c05f2b6b03324942b9f75c0c337
spent
true